voluntary arrangement definition

voluntary arrangement means either a company voluntary arrangement or an individual voluntary arrangement, as applicable.
voluntary arrangement means a voluntary arrangement which has effect in relation to a UK insurer in accordance with section 4A of the 1986 Act or Article 17A of the 1989 Order; and
voluntary arrangement means an arrangement as defined in Article 14(1).
